Students Learn About The Fun Side of Science
More than 1,000 middle and high school students came to UTSA last week for the third annual Engineering and Science Extravaganza.
The conference was hosted by the Society of Mexican American Engineers and Scientists (MAES) for participants in the Prefreshman Engineering Program (PREP) who came from across Texas.
Ford Motor Company, DuPont and Alamo Workforce Development were major sponsors of the event. More than 34 organizations were represented at the conference where young people learned about science and engineering in hands-on learning sessions.
A benefit golf tournament was held June 14 at Golf Clubs of Texas in conjunction with the extravaganza. The tourney was organized to raise money for MAES scholarships, and it is hoped that it will become an annual event.
The Extravaganza has seen tremendous growth over the last three years. The first event consisted of 300 PREP students and 12 presenters. The second had 800 students and 34 presenters.
